Key Specifications
§ Lens construction: 12
groups, 17 elements (1 SLD lens)
§ Angle of view: 23.3°
§ Number of diaphragm blades:
9 (rounded diaphragm)
§ Minimum aperture: F22
§ Minimum focusing distance:
29.5cm / 11.6in.
§ Maximum magnification
ratio: 1:1
§ Filter size: 62mm
§ Maximum dimensions x
length: 74mm×133.6mm / 2.9x5.3in.
§ Weight: 715g / 25.2oz.

Everything required in a mid-telephoto macro lens has been achieved at
highest levels
The
latest optical design of the 105mm F2.8 DG DN MACRO | Art ensures exceptional
sharpness at all shooting distances from extreme close-up, which is crucial in
macro shooting, all the way up to infinity. In addition, its aberration
correction places a particular focus on longitudinal chromatic aberration which
cannot be handled by the in-camera aberration correction. The superior optical
design produces clear images with both delicate rendering and free of color
bleeding.
Bokeh
was one of the focuses in the 105mm F2.8 DG DN MACRO | Art design, which
figures largely in mid-telephoto shooting. The ample volume of peripheral light
helps create beautiful bokeh circles, while natural bokeh effect in the
background, as well as foreground, gives more flexibility to photographic
expressions. Furthermore, when equipped with the TC-1411 (1.4x) or
TC-2011 (2.0x), SIGMA's latest models of teleconverters designed exclusively
for the use with L-Mount lenses, it allows photographers to shoot macro at even
higher macro magnifications while keeping the working distance.
The
105mm F2.8 DG DN MACRO | Art has achieved everything that is required of a
mid-telephoto macro lens at the highest levels.

A full range of functionalities and an excellent build quality
On
its body, the 105mm F2.8 DG DN MACRO | Art features a focus limiter setting
which comes in handy during macro shooting and the AFL button* to which users
may assign select functions. The aperture ring, which is designed to help users
work intuitively, has a setting to turn ON or OFF the clicking sound that isn’t
required by some users when shooting macro. It also comes with a switch for a
ring lock system. Its enhanced functions allow users to customize their
shooting operations in accordance with their shooting styles.
The
lens also has a dust- and splash-proof structure which is built to handle all
manner of shooting conditions. The rings and switches, meanwhile, have a build
quality that is superb in terms of durability, as well as how they work and how
they feel.
